Gregory Forrester Obituary

Gregory S. Forrester

1962-2023

Gregory "Greg" Forrester, 61, of Perrysburg, OH passed away at St. Vincent Medical Center on April 24, 2023. He was born March 2, 1962 in Toledo, OH. Greg met Trish Rigby at the age of 16 and they were married on December 17, 1988. Together they raised 3 children.

Greg graduated from Northview High School in 1980 where he ran cross country and wrestled and then attended Ohio University. After beginning his career in the steel industry, his determination and persistent personality allowed him to start his own successful steel company, Toledo Steel Supply. With Greg's aggressive personality, he took a small shop and turned it into one of the largest steel plate suppliers in the Midwest. The amazing, quick growth of the company is a true testament to Greg's high-energy, go-getter style. He surrounded himself with hardworking, loyal employees who admired and respected his drive and vision. Greg took great pride in knowing his employees had confidence in his ability to provide and mentor them.

Aside from the business, Greg had many other passions. When their children were young, a cottage at Devil's Lake was enjoyed by his entire family and friends. He loved bringing people together to enjoy water skiing, jet skiing, tubing, snowmobiling and moments spent around the bonfire. Eventually, he wanted to be on a larger lake, so the family went off to Catawba Island where they became members at CIC. There he enjoyed boat trips throughout the Great Lakes, making life-long friends along the way.

Greg and Trish bought a home in the Florida Keys, where he enjoyed fishing, boating, quality time with the family and again, making an abundance of new friends. He also loved their home on Lake Charlevoix where he continued boating, riding his side-by-side, and grilling for the family. And of course, more friends were added to the list.

His hobbies were endless. His performance sport cars, RV's, boats and motorcycles were just a few. The family took many trips together to exciting destinations, including the Caribbean, Hawaii, Vail ski trips at Christmas, while making life-long memories.

Greg's generous and adventurous spirit will continue to live through his family. No one forgets meeting Greg Forrester; he was one of a kind. Greg also gave the gift of life through organ donation.

Greg is survived by his loving wife, Trish; children, Andrew, Abbey and Ava; mother, Pat Forrester; siblings, Tom (Ruth) Forrester, Julie Forrester and Patrick (Donna) Forrester; and many nieces and nephews. Preceding him in death was his father, Tom Forrester.

Visitation will be at the Reeb Funeral Home, Sylvania, on Tuesday, May 2, 2023 from 3:00 p.m. until 8:00 p.m. The Funeral Mass will be at St. Rose Catholic Church, Perrysburg, on Wednesday, May 3, 2023 at 11:00 a.m. Interment will follow at Toledo Memorial Park. The family suggests donations in Greg's name be made to St. Jude Children's Research Hospital.
